The Associate Director, Financial Analysis (12-month contract) plays a pivotal role in supporting the finance team's operational workload and advancing strategic and transformational projects. The role centers on structured project execution and reliable financial analysis across forecasting, reporting, workforce planning, and compensation modeling. The contract position is suited to someone with strong analytical skills, practical project management experience, and the ability to work effectively with teams across the business to keep plans and processes moving forward smoothly. Key Responsibilities Strategic Finance and Project Leadership: Execute finance-led strategic and transformational projects Manage project scope, timelines, communication, and coordination across Finance, HR, IT, and business partners Support adoption and engagement through clear communication and change management Executive Analysis and Advisory: Deliver ad hoc analysis, scenario modeling, and briefing materials for senior leadership Conduct targeted research to support policy questions, strategic decisions, and corporate initiatives FP&A, Reporting, and Workforce Planning Support budgeting, forecasting, and long-range planning cycles Prepare or support monthly reporting, variance analysis, and performance commentary, including improvements to KPI frameworks and benchmarking Produce workforce planning analyses including hiring plans and cost assessments Finance Operations and Data Support: Assist with finance workflows that require structured analysis or coordination Assess and optimize Finance processes for efficiency and automation Support digital transformation projects that reduce manual effort and improve data quality Maintain reporting, models, and templates tied to established finance processes Qualifications: 8+ years of progressive experience in finance, corporate strategy, and/or consulting Proven track record of managing complex, cross-functional strategic initiatives Hands-on experience selecting, implementing, and managing financial and operational systems Interest and experience in adopting new technologies and exploring innovative ways of working Strong understanding of transactional finance operations Exceptional analytical, research, and problem-solving skills Skilled in project management and adept at prioritizing and coordinating diverse teams Excellent communication and executive presentation skills Proficiency in Power BI, Power Query and other platforms to drive automation and enable finance transformation Education & Credentials: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or related field required. CPA, MBA, or relevant graduate qualification strongly preferred.
